Public Hearing on Mayport's Future
Tonight is your chance to weigh in on the proposed plan to homeport a nuclear carrier at Naval Station Mayport.
The Navy is hosting a public hearing on the Southside to talk about the economic and environmental impact of adding additional ships at Mayport...
Based on the preliminary projections by the Draft Environmental Impact Statement, the cost to bring new ships, including a nuclear carrier, would be between $390 and $490 million, and the base will need many improvements to its facilities.
Navy brass, politicians and business leaders will be in attendance at tonight's public hearing.
